Admission to SPJIMR courses is based on merit or entrance exam scores of the candidates. For PGDM/ PGPM, candidates are required to pass CAT/ GMAT followed by a personal interview round. The selection for Online PGDM is based on a personal interview round. Candidates are required to meet the selection requirements for admission to any of the PG programmes. For FPM, admission is based on the Research Aptitude Test followed by PI. Besides, admission to GMP programme is based on CAT, XAT, GMAT, GRE followed by PI round. Hence, direct admission is not possible.

In order to be enrolled into one of GNIMS Mumbai's illustrious Management courses, candidates must make sure that they fulfil the prescribed eligibility criteria. Students looking to take admissions in MMS or MCA must achieve at least 50% in their graduate degrees.
Also, since admissions are entrance-score based, students must have valid scoring in any of the qualifying Management exams: MAH-MBA/MMS-CET)/CAT/MAT/ATMA/CMAT. Separate conditions exist for admissions into the diploma/certificate and the doctorate programs.
